    PD injector clamp bolt torque

    Hi I just replaced the seals on the injectors on my 2.0Tdi 16V 170, engine code BRD. The Audi manual says the new bolts are tightened to only 3Nm before a 90 degree then a 180 degree final set. This seemed a very low torque setting to me and the bolts did not “feel” tight even after the angle...

    P0299 error code

    Hi I just had a run up a hill & got these readings of intake absolute pressure during a full throttle pull. At idle 97kPa Peak in 2nd 210kPa Peak in 3rd 235kPa Peak in 4th 190kPa but it cut into limp mode at this point. I make the boost figures as follows; 2nd 16psi 3rd 20psi 4th 13.5...
